Download Android 3.0 Animations: Beginner's Guide by Alex Shaw PDF

By Alex Shaw

Carry your Android functions to existence with gorgeous animations. the 1st and basically ebook devoted to growing animations for Android apps. Covers the entire frequent animation concepts for Android 3.0 and reduce models. Create gorgeous animations to provide your Android apps a enjoyable and intuitive consumer event. A step by step advisor for studying animation by means of construction enjoyable instance purposes and video games. intimately An relaxing, comprehensible, and attention-grabbing consumer interface is a key a part of getting clients to like your app. clients this present day anticipate a refined multimedia event on their cellular gadget, and animation is a middle a part of that. The Android working method is on the vanguard of pill and telephone know-how, and there's a plethora of possibilities for constructing intriguing purposes with animation. Android 3.0 Animations Beginner's consultant will introduce all the most well-liked animation thoughts to you. utilizing step by step directions, you'll how you can create interactive dynamic types, relocating photos, and 3D movement. you'll be taken on a trip from basic cease movement animations and fades, via to relocating enter types, then directly to 3D movement and online game snap shots. during this booklet, you are going to create standalone lively pics, 3-dimensional lifts, fades, and spins. you are going to turn into adept at relocating and remodeling shape facts to convey uninteresting previous enter types and monitors to existence. learn the way video game programmers create speedy animations at the fly, and additionally construct stay wallpapers to brighten up your clients home-screens! while you're uninterested in writing useless interfaces and wish so as to add a few lively pleasure, this is often the publication for you! A step-by step consultant for developing, checking out, and employing lovely animations for android purposes and video games. What you are going to research from this booklet Create lively pics from a suite of nonetheless pictures Fade among graphical components circulation, distort, and customarily fiddle with components of your consumer interface Create superb 3D movement with a number of easy ideas Strip again the Android person interface to create quickly lively images at the fly adventure outstanding effects by means of altering your animation's rhythm Create a reside wallpaper to convey movement in your home-screen layout your animations to appear nice and paintings good on diverse Android units process Written in Packt's Beginner's advisor sequence, this e-book takes a step by step strategy with every one bankruptcy made from 3 to 5 tutorials that introduce and clarify diverse animation innovations. All recommendations are defined with real-world examples which are enjoyable to learn and paintings with. Who this publication is written for when you are conversant in constructing Android functions and wish to carry your apps to existence by means of including smashing animations, then this ebook is for you. The ebook assumes that you're happy with Java improvement and feature familiarity with developing Android perspectives in XML and Java. The tutorials suppose that you will need to paintings with Eclipse, yet you could paintings simply besides along with your most well-liked improvement instruments.

Show description

Read or Download Android 3.0 Animations: Beginner's Guide PDF

Similar game programming books

C++ Programming for the Absolute Beginner

While you're new to programming with C++ and are trying to find a superior creation, this is often the booklet for you. constructed via computing device technology teachers, books within the "For absolutely the Beginner"? sequence educate the rules of programming via easy video game construction. you'll collect the talents that you just desire for more effective C++ programming functions and may learn the way those talents could be placed to take advantage of in real-world eventualities.

Mathematics for Game Developers

Arithmetic for online game builders is simply that—a math booklet designed in particular for the sport developer, no longer the mathematician. As a video game developer, you recognize that math is a primary a part of your programming arsenal. with a view to application a video game that is going past the fundamentals, you want to first grasp thoughts reminiscent of matrices and vectors.

Pro Java 6 3D Game Development: Java 3D, JOGL, JInput and JOAL APIs (Expert's Voice in Java)

This publication appears to be like on the preferred methods of utilizing Java SE 6 to jot down 3D video games on desktops: Java 3D (a high-level scene graph API) and JOGL (a Java layer over OpenGL). Written by way of Java gaming professional, Andrew Davison, this e-book can be first Java video game e-book to marketplace that makes use of the hot Java (SE) 6 platform and its positive factors together with splash monitors, scripting, and the machine tray interface.

Translation and Localisation in Video Games: Making Entertainment Software Global

This booklet is a multidisciplinary research of the interpretation and localisation of games. It bargains a descriptive research of the – understood as a world phenomenon in leisure – and goals to provide an explanation for the norms governing current practices, in addition to video game localisation techniques.

Additional resources for Android 3.0 Animations: Beginner's Guide

Example text

Now to wire them in to the buttons! funky. FunkyActivity. ) 7. OnClickListener(){ public void onClick(View v) { // We'll fill this in in a minute too! } } ); Just to get us started, we've defined two onClick interactions, to which we will add our animations. 8. Now to populate the onClickListener of the danceLeftButton with the actual animations! Let's start where we wrote We'll fill this in in a minute. We want to add three new lines of code to this method. I'll explain each one as we go along.

In this particular example, we used the de-facto Android way to show images of different sizes, which is to say that we provided HDPI, MDPI, and LDPI versions of all the PNG images. If a user has a small screen, then the LDPI graphics are used. 0 devices) the device has a large, high-resolution screen, then we want to increase the resolution of the image to take advantage of this fact. Sometimes you run out of memory If, like me, you like to have a few graphical elements on screen at once, you will occasionally discover that your little mobile phone is not quite as powerful as your desktop computer when it comes to showing animations.

11. Firstly, let's add the classes we're going to be working with. I'll describe them briefly here. You will see how they are used shortly. Bundle; AnimationDrawable is Android's Java representation of the animation-list that we created in step 3. xml. xml layout. We will access it through the onCreate() method in FunkyActivity, so that we start the animation as soon as the application [ 36 ] Chapter 2 is loaded. public class FunkyActivity extends Activity { /** Called when the activity is first created.

Download PDF sample

Rated 4.98 of 5 – based on 44 votes